PRECURSOR FOR CATHODE ACTIVE MATERIALS FOR LITHIUMSECONDARY BATTERY, CATHODE ACTIVE MATERIALS AND LITHIUMSECONDARY BATTERY USING THE SAME, AND PREPARATION METHOD THEREOF |
摘要 |
PURPOSE: A manufacturing method of a positive electrode active material is provided to have a uniform particle size and improve electrochemical properties by mixing a lithium salt and a precursor which has a controlled surface. CONSTITUTION: A manufacturing method of a positive electrode active material for a lithium secondary battery comprises following steps: a step(S1) of manufacturing a metal aqueous solution by mixing three kinds of material selected from nickel, cobalt, iron, manganese and aluminum; a step(S2) of obtaining a precipitate by putting the mixture into a continuous reactor and stirring the mixture after mixing sodium carbonate as a precipitator and an ammonia solution as a co-precipitator in the metal aqueous solution; a step of manufacturing a precursor by filtering, washing, and drying the precipitate; and a step(S3) of mixing the precursor and a lithium salt.
